Police: No sign of person in distress on Mcteer Bridge

A boat cruises along the Beaufort River underneath the J.E. McTeer Bridge on June 3, 2025, that connects Port Royal to Lady’s Island.
A boat cruises along the Beaufort River underneath the J.E. McTeer Bridge on June 3, 2025, that connects Port Royal to Lady’s Island. dmartin@islandpacket.com

Police investigated reports of a person in distress on the Mcteer Bridge Wednesday morning, but were not able to find any evidence that there was one.

No individuals have been located in the water, near the bridge connecting Port Royal and Lady’s Island. However, “out of an abundance of caution,” emergency personnel conducted a thorough search of the area, according to the Beaufort County Sheriff’s Office.

As of 11:15 a.m., police had already cleared the area, according to spokesperson Lt. Daniel Allen. Police still advise for boaters and motorists in the area to keep an eye out for suspicious activity.

The bridge does have a one-mile walking path with a view over the Beaufort River.
